Web-Based Attendance Information System At Diskominfosantik Bekasi District With Prototype Method
The rapid development of information technology has encouraged government agencies to utilize digital systems to improve operational efficiency and effectiveness, including in managing employee attendance data. This study aims to design and implement a Web-Based Attendance Information System at the Department of Communication, Informatics, Statistics, and Encryption (Diskominfosantik) of Bekasi Regency. The system was developed using the prototype method, allowing for a gradual design process involving users directly in evaluation and development. The main features of the system include login authentication for administrators and employees, barcode scanning for attendance validation, GPS data integration to verify attendance locations, digital leave requests, and real-time attendance data management and reporting. System testing was conducted using the black box testing method across various scenarios to ensure all functions operated as expected without errors. The system design is also supported by use case and class diagrams that illustrate the workflow and relationships between entities in the system. The results of the study indicate that the web-based attendance information system can improve recording accuracy, accelerate the attendance data recap process, and support transparency in personnel management. Thus, the system has the potential to serve as a model for other government agencies in digitizing employee attendance processes

A CONTRADICTORY RELATIONS AND PERPETUATION OF COLONIAL DISCOURSE IN INDONESIA DARI PINGGIR BY FATRIS MF
This research aims to describe the travel novel Indonesia dari Pinggir by Fatris MF that tries to convey to the world the charm of people, culture, and regions in the Eastern part of Indonesia. However, at the same time, the author presents contradictory narratives, irony, negotiation, and efforts to accommodate the voice of the East to be in dialogue and even contrasted with the West. Therefore, the researcher conducted an academic exploration of the author's ambivalent position, simultaneously resisting and perpetuating the colonial discourse. This research is descriptive qualitative research. The data in this research were taken from the novel Indonesia dari Pinggir by Fatris MF, consisting of words, phrases, sentences, paragraphs, and dialog between characters related to the research problem. Using Carl Thompson's concept of travel writing, the researcher found that the strategies of reporting the world and representing the other in this novel reveal the eastern Indonesian people who are often described as "the other" through exotic, primitive, and inferior. A narrative of revealing the self emphasizes the author's personal experience as a critical analysis in revealing the dynamics of the representation of eastern Indonesia in travel narratives.Keywords: colonial discourse, contradictory relation, deviation strategy, Indonesia dari Pinggir, travel literatur
Optimizing firewall timing for brute force mitigation with random forests
Mitigating brute force attacks remains a critical challenge in cybersecurity, requiring intelligent and adaptive solutions. This research introduces an approach to optimizing firewall deployment timing for enhanced brute force mitigation using pattern recognition techniques with the random forest algorithm. Leveraging the UNSW-NB15 dataset, comprehensive preprocessing and exploratory data analysis (EDA) were performed to ensure the dataset's suitability for machine learning applications. The study utilized a structured workflow, splitting the dataset into training and testing subsets to rigorously evaluate the model's performance. The proposed random forest model achieved a high accuracy of 98.87%, supported by precision, recall, and F1-scores that confirm its effectiveness in distinguishing normal and attack traffic. The confusion matrix further validated the model’s robustness, highlighting its potential in improving the efficiency of firewall deployment. These findings demonstrate the critical role of advanced machine learning techniques in enhancing cybersecurity defenses, particularly in mitigating brute force attacks through optimized, data-driven strategies
PENANAMAN NILAI MODERASI BERAGAMA DALAM MATA PELAJARAN PAI DI SD NEGERI 215/III DESA KEBUN BARU
Religious Moderation Values are values that need to be instilled in a pluralistic environment such as the village of Kebun Baru. As a village that includes various languages, religions and ethnicities, it is important to inculcate the value of moderation. Instilling the value of moderation aims to avoid divisions that may arise due to differences. In this activity of Cultivating the Value of Religious Moderation the author specializes in the 215/III Kebun Baru State Elementary School where students at this school need to know these values from an early age. As for the implementation, the author uses the method of teaching, demonstration, and lecture. The results of this service are instilling the attitude of tawasuth so that students can be honest with themselves and the surrounding environment, the attitude of tasamuh so that students can be respectful of each other, and I\u27tidal so that students can be consistent and confident in their potential. . With this moderation-based service activity program, it will further strengthen Indonesian unity
